Comparative Analysis of EIA Legal Frameworks by Region
Environmental Impact Assessment laws vary significantly across regions, reflecting differing legal traditions, environmental priorities, and institutional capacities. A comparative analysis reveals notable disparities in legal frameworks, scope, and enforcement mechanisms that influence project approvals worldwide.
Some regions, such as the European Union, enforce comprehensive EIA laws integrated into broader environmental policies, emphasizing public participation and precautionary principles. Conversely, countries like the United States rely on sector-specific regulations, such as the National Environmental Policy Act, with varying levels of stringency.
In Asia and Africa, legal frameworks often face challenges related to enforcement and resource constraints, leading to gaps between legislation and practical implementation. Developing countries tend to focus on economic growth, sometimes at the expense of rigorous EIA procedures.

Baseline Environmental Data Collection
Baseline environmental data collection is a fundamental step in the Environmental Impact Assessment (EIA) process. It involves gathering comprehensive information about existing environmental conditions within the project area prior to development activities. This data provides a critical reference point to evaluate potential impacts accurately.
Data collection typically encompasses various environmental components, such as air and water quality, soil characteristics, flora and fauna distributions, and socio-economic factors. Reliable baseline data ensures that subsequent impact predictions are grounded in factual conditions, reducing uncertainties and enhancing assessment accuracy.
Across different jurisdictions, methods for baseline data collection can vary, but all emphasize accuracy, representativeness, and consistency. Sometimes, long-term monitoring and the use of emerging technologies, such as remote sensing and geographic information systems (GIS), are integrated to improve data quality. This foundation is vital for determining the significance of potential impacts and developing effective mitigation measures.

Case Studies Illustrating Global EIA Legal Approaches
Multiple case studies highlight the diverse applications of environmental impact assessment laws worldwide. For instance, the ambitious Line 3 pipeline project in Canada faced extensive legal scrutiny due to environmental concerns, demonstrating the importance of strict EIA processes in preventing ecological damage. Conversely, China’s large-scale Guangdong-Hong Kong-Macau Greater Bay Area development was subject to comprehensive EIAs, underscoring the role of legal frameworks in guiding sustainable urban expansion.
In contrast, controversial projects such as Brazil’s Belo Monte dam experienced legal disputes stemming from inadequate environmental assessments, revealing challenges in balancing development and environmental protection. These cases illustrate how different jurisdictions enforce EIA laws to varying degrees, affecting project approval and public confidence.
Overall, global EIA legal approaches utilize diverse compliance mechanisms, yet face common challenges like enforcement gaps and stakeholder engagement, emphasizing the need for continuous legal evolution aligned with environmental and social priorities.
